Homicide cold cases grow chillier as clues disappear, police resources dwindle

As 9-year-old Beth Ringheim struggled to make sense of the gruesome murder scene in her father’s Dublin home, she formed a terrifying question: Who would do such a thing?... Such cases continue to dog detectives in agencies around the Bay Area as resources dwindle or clues and memories fade away.

In case anyone didn't notice it point your mouse at one of the dots on the map and click on it. For example for Antioch on the upper right (upper right of all the dots shown) it will show:
AGENCY: Antioch
DATE: 6/27/1980
VICTIM(S): Susan Bombardier
AGE: 14
LOCATION: San Joaquin RIver
CAUSE: Stabbing
DESCRIPTION: Victim disappeared while babysitting and was found in a river near Big Break Harbor. Her nude body was found floating in the San Joaquin River.
